Dobrý den, potýkám se s rychlostí webu. GT Metrix i PageSpeed Insights mi píší „Reduce the number of DOM elements“. Jak mohu snížit DOM? Přečetla jsem si příspěvky pro zkušenější a moc se v nich nevyznám. Znamená to například snížit počet obrázků v příspěvku?
Moc Vám děkuji.
Tereza Krček
Zdravím,
zkuste například plugin Autoptimize nebo nějaký podobný.
https://www.wplama.cz/autoptimize-minifikaci-ve-wordpress/
Hezký den. Přesně toto, mimo jiné, mě píšou výsledky také. Problémem je příliš veliký DOM. Pokud jsem to dobře pochopil, jedná se délku URL adres. Čím více pod stránek, tím větší. Například http://www.domena.cz/zpravy/domaci/pocasi …
DOM elementy (Document Object Model) je prakticky struktura stránky (DIV, HTML, BODY). Používá se ve spojení s CSS a JS.
Snížení DOM u CMS s nějakou šablonou může být složitější.
Zřejmě jde o web https://mamadodeste.cz (hosting savana.cz) + šablona REHub. Určitě bych nějak redukoval počet těch načítaných dat na stránce. Dále bych využil klasické stránkování třeba 6 příspěvků na stránku (https://mamadodeste.cz/category/tvoreni-3/). Ono je tam toho k doladění dost a dost.
Hezký den,
děkuji za komentáře. Plugin Autoptimize (a dalších 15 dalších) jsem zkoušela, ale ve výsledku se web zpomalí, DOM se nesníží, zvýší se doba načítání obrázků.
Redukovat počet načítaných dat na stránku znamená například odstranit nějaké widgety? Děkuji za připomínku ke stránkování, už jsem ji upravila.
Tak hodně widgetů na stránce zpomaluje načítání určitě, zkušenost vlastní. Hlavně některé jako je zobrazení náhledu Facebook stránky a podobných, úložiště fotografií, ale i online chaty. A pak hodně zpomalují načítání scripty a obrázky. S pluginy se to zlepší, ale asi ne jak by člověk potřeboval (vlastní zkušenost). Taky je potřeba je umět nastavit.